Grace motivates Christians to give freely and joyfully, reflecting the love of Christ.
The motivation for Christian generosity stems from the transformative effect of grace in the believer's life. In 2 Corinthians 8:8-9, we see that Paul does not command giving; rather, he encourages it by highlighting the grace of Christ as the ultimate example. When believers understand how much they have received through God's grace—liberating them from sin and granting them righteousness—they are moved to extend that same grace to others. This joyful giving is not a mere obligation but a heartfelt response to the love they have experienced, leading them to share their resources generously. The grace of God kindles a desire to love and serve others, resonating with Christ’s own selfless acts.
